Bill English

Prime Minister of New Zealand from 2016 to 2017

Origins and Family

Bill English's place of birth was Lumsden[2]. He was born on December 30, 1961[3].

Education

Educated at Victoria University of Wellington[9], a public university[28], in New Zealand[29], founded in 1897[30], headquartered in Wellington[31] and University of Otago[10], a public university[32], in New Zealand[33], founded in 1869[34], headquartered in Dunedin[35].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include politician[4] and farmer[5]. Bill English's field of work was English-language literature[8].

Recognition

Awards received include Knight Companion of the New Zealand Order of Merit‎[11], a grade of an order[36], in New Zealand[37]; honorary doctor of the University of Otago[12], an award[38], in New Zealand[39]; and honorary doctor of Victoria University of Wellington[13], an award[40], in New Zealand[41].
